In a shocking incident, Mick Jagger's partner, Melanie Hamrick, was left traumatized after being assaulted outside a prestigious club. The 38-year-old dancer revealed on Instagram that she was unexpectedly grabbed from behind, an experience she described as 'incredibly hard to share.'
But here's where it gets personal: Hamrick, a former ballerina, found herself in a vulnerable position, only to be rescued by her friends who intervened. This incident raises questions about personal safety in public spaces, especially for women.
The attack occurred after Hamrick dined with friends at a nearby restaurant and then proceeded to Annabel's, a private members' club in Mayfair. The club has been in the spotlight recently due to another disturbing incident involving a woman's drink being spiked.
And this is where the story takes a twist: Just days prior, a London restaurateur was convicted of spiking a woman's drink at the same club. This raises concerns about the safety of such establishments and the potential risks patrons may face.
